Embodiment 1
[0036] Such as figure 1 and figure 2 As shown, a wheel inner distance measuring device 100 includes a bracket 1, the bracket 1 includes a base plate 10, and the base plate 10 is provided with a laser sensor 2 and a camera 3, and the laser sensor 2 scans laser light to the inner side of the wheel, so The irradiation range of the camera 3 covers the scanning range of the laser sensor 2, and the data acquired by the laser sensor 2 and the camera 3 are uploaded to the controller for distance measurement.

Embodiment 2
[0048] Such as image 3 As shown, a wheel inner distance measurement system includes several said wheel inner distance measuring devices 100, and several said wheel inner distance measuring devices 100 are placed at intervals between two parallel first rails 4 and second rails 5 In the middle, the top surface of the wheel inner distance measuring device 100 is lower than the rail; the first rail 4 is for the left wheel 6 to travel, and the second rail 5 is for the right wheel 7 to travel;
[0049] In a specific embodiment, several groups of wheel inner distance measuring devices 100 can be set in the middle of two parallel rails, and the wheel inner distance measuring devices 100 can be arranged at intervals, for example, four groups can be placed, and the same wheel can be scanned multiple times to obtain Multiple sets of data can improve the accuracy of measurement.

Embodiment 3
[0056] Such as Figure 4 and Figure 5 As shown, a method for measuring the inner distance of a wheel, using the said inner distance measurement system, comprises the following steps:
[0057] Step 101: When the train wheels pass by, activate the wheel inner distance measurement system to work, replace the left wheel 6 and the right wheel 7 with two planar plates 14 connected together by connecting rods 13, the connection The length of the rod 13 is L, and the thickness of the planar plate 14 is T;
[0058] Step 102: The first laser sensor 20 and the third laser sensor 8 scan the two planes inside and outside of the flat panel 14 respectively; the second laser sensor 21 and the fourth laser sensor 9 scan respectively The inner and outer two planes of the other said plane plate 14;
